Store to store for cancer charity

By Neil Speight 1st Aug 2020

A HAPPY band of fundraisers stepped out into the heat of the midday sun today (Saturday, 1 August) to boost a cancer charity.

A group of five took part in a sponsored walk from Morrisons in Grays to the sister store in Corringham.

They were walking for Clic Sargent and residents are invited to sponsor then via this link .

The event was organised by Grays store community champion Tarnya Bennett and among those joining her was Tom Flynn of the local Prince's Trust who said: "Ready for our walk to Morrison in Corringham (10miles) for 'Clic Sargent' with some of Morrisons staff who have been supporting us throughout this pandemic.

"They have been donating essentials for our community. Now it's our turn to support them."
